Lives are busy and living costs are high which has an effect on all decisions we make in our lives. Even the kind of flooring we choose. Hardwood flooring no doubt looks great and lasts long but they are also expensive and require significant amount of tending. No one has the time for that. That is why laminate flooring in Sydney is becoming a much more preferred choice than hardwood flooring. The reason is simple, it is easy to maintain, durable and inexpensive compared to hardwood. However, to make sure that your laminate floors are really worth your dollar, you need to keep certain considerations in mind.

Choose The Right Vendor – Seeing the popularity of laminate flooring in Sydney, everyone is jumping on the laminate bandwagon. But not everyone is qualified to make laminate floorings that stand the test of time. Always choose a vendor that has sufficient years of experience under their belt and has a good reputation in the market. Make all the required enquiries before investing your trust and money into a company. Make sure they are certified, offer warranty and not some random name you picked up from the classifieds. Although laminate floors are cheaper than hardwood floors, they are still a significant investment by the sheer body of work you are about to do so choose wisely.

Choose The Right Laminate – Just because they are meant to last, does not mean that all types of laminates will have the same tenacity. There are various grades of laminates that depend on thickness, the material used and the way it is created. As common sense states, the thinnest form of laminate will be of the cheapest quality. The thinner you go the more number of years you can knock off from its tenure. Use this only if you like to change your flooring in one or two years because that is about the time it will last you. Another thing to consider is what type of backing it has. Paperback is of course more fragile than the melamine backed laminates. Also make sure that the core of the laminate flooring is made up of High Density Fiber to ensure maximum strength.

Choose the right Installer – Although installing laminate flooring in Sydney is fairly easy, that only holds true if everything else about the floor is in mint condition. If not, you need help. Since laminate flooring has to be installed atop a subfloor, the subfloor needs to be in the right condition to make the laminate stable. An experienced installer will level the floor, making sure that the sub floor is not faulty and stable enough to support the laminate flooring. Moreover, there needs to be an additional layer of foam that needs to go over the sub floor and below the laminate flooring. This is something amateur installers and DIY enthusiasts might not know about. The foam layer acts as an insulator, a moisture barrier and a sound proofer. 

Choosing the right laminate flooring in Sydney will ensure that your house looks new for ages, as laminate is highly durable and scratch resistant. It will cut down your maintenance time as it can be cleaned with regular cleaning products. However, choosing the wrong one would only translate into years of headache and repairs.
